首页 理论教育 使用DataGridView控件展示数据库数据

使用DataGridView控件展示数据库数据

时间:2023-10-21 理论教育 版权反馈
【摘要】:上一小节中我们把数据库中的信息填充到了数据集中,怎样利用DataGridView显示在窗体上呢?表6-12dept表结构表6-13emp表结构向这两张表分别添加如下数据:第二步:添加窗体控件,然后在窗体中添加一个DataGridView控件和一个“点击显示emp表中数据”的按钮,控件的属性如表6-14所示。要指定DataGridView的数据源只要使用一行代码,设置DataGridView的DataSource属性就能达到目的。在btnShowData按钮的Click事件中,添加两行代码。示例用DataGridView显示emp表中的信息,并分别以别名显示。

使用DataGridView控件展示数据库数据

上一小节中我们把数据库中的信息填充到了数据集中,怎样利用DataGridView显示在窗体上呢?只要三步就够了。

第一步:数据库设计(数据库名dept_emp),数据库中有两张数据表,数据表dept结构设计如表6-12所示,数据表emp结构设计如表6-13所示。

表6-12 dept表结构

表6-13 emp表结构

向这两张表分别添加如下数据:

第二步:添加窗体控件,然后在窗体中添加一个DataGridView控件和一个“点击显示emp表中数据”的按钮,控件的属性如表6-14所示。

表6-14 控件及属性设置

窗体设计效果如图6-8所示。(www.xing528.com)

图6-8 添加窗体控件

第三步:在按钮的Click事件中添加显示数据源的代码。

要指定DataGridView的数据源只要使用一行代码,设置DataGridView的DataSource属性就能达到目的。在btnShowData按钮的Click事件中,添加两行代码。整个FrmDataGridView.cs的代码如示例代码6-1所示。

示例用DataGridView显示emp表中的信息,并分别以别名(员工编号、部门编号、姓名、薪水)显示。

整个程序运行,点击按钮后的显示效果如图6-9所示。

图6-9 程序运行结果

小贴士

如果要连接Sql Server数据库,那么需要添加命名空间using System.Data.SqlClient;

免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。

我要反馈